CVE-2025-4425
CVE-2025-4425 concerns InsydeH2O firmware used in Lenovo devices. Concrete details across connected documents indicate a stack overflow in the SMI handler, enabling a local attacker with privileges to potentially gain deep system control. CVE-2025-7026
A vulnerability in the Software SMI handler SwSmiInputValue 0xB2 allows a local attacker to control the RBX register, which is used as an unchecked pointer in the CommandRcx0 function. If the contents at RBX match certain expected values e.g., '$DB$' or '2DB$', the function performs arbitrary...

CVE-2025-7028
A vulnerability in the Software SMI handler SwSmiInputValue 0x20 allows a local attacker to supply a crafted pointer FuncBlock through RBX and RCX register values. This pointer is passed unchecked into multiple flash management functions ReadFlash, WriteFlash, EraseFlash, and GetFlashInfo that...
CVE-2025-7029
A vulnerability in the Software SMI handler SwSmiInputValue 0xB2 allows a local attacker to control the RBX register, which is used to derive pointers OcHeader, OcData passed into power and thermal configuration logic. These buffers are not validated before performing multiple structured memory...
